The Change Room is hiring a full-time Purchasing Officer in Victoria Island, Lagos. The role involves reviewing product quality, negotiating contracts, evaluating suppliers, researching vendors, and tracking orders. Candidates need a Bachelor's Degree in Business, Supply Chain, or Finance, 3–5 years of experience, strong negotiation skills, and proficiency in inventory software.

Purchasing Officer at The Change Room ⏲ Aug 10, 2026, 4:00 AM ⋕ View all Procurement & Supply Chain jobs Changeroom was established in 2012 with a vision to produce quality human resource solutions. We plan to achieve this by partnering with our clients to provide highly specialized consulting services in the areas of human resources development and business management services. Our partnership approach affords us the opportunity of working with you to find the most efficient and appropriate solutions to meet your short, medium and long-term goals. In partnering with your organization, we make it our business to understand your business, embrace its values, aims and objectives. We are recruiting to fill the position below: Job Title: Purchasing Officer Location: Victoria Island, Lagos Employment Type: Full-time Responsibilities: Review quality of purchased products Negotiate contract terms of agreement and pricing Compare and evaluate offers from suppliers Research potential vendors Track orders and ensure timely delivery Requirements: and skills Solid analytical skills, with the ability to create financial reports and conduct cost analyses A Bachelor’s Degree in Business, Supply Chain, or Finance, 3 - 5years of experience, strong negotiation skills, and proficiency in inventory software. In Nigeria, a completed NYSC discharge Negotiation skills. Hands-on experience: with purchasing software (e.g. Procurify or SpendMap) Good knowledge of vendor sourcing practices (researching, evaluating and liaising with vendors) Understanding of supply chain procedures Proven work experience: as a Purchasing Officer, Purchasing agent, or similar role How to Apply Interested and qualified candidates should send their CV to: [email protected] / [email protected] using the Job Title as the subject of the mail.
